.SH DESCRIPTION
.PP
Get the number of video "adapters" attached to the computer.
Each video card attached to the computer counts as one or more adapters.
An adapter is thus really a video port that can have a monitor connected
to it.
.PP
On Windows, use al_set_new_display_flags(3) to switch between Direct3D
and OpenGL backends, which will often have different adapters available.
